Abstract
Currently, the cutting of Oil Palm Frond (OPF) using a sickle attached to a long pole is still widely practiced. To advance the state of current harvesting method, MPOB has introduced a new technology, which is a mechanized cutter, Cantas. The mechanize cutter operate using a small engine and vibrating sickle to cut the OPF and fruit bunch on tree. This project continues development in the field of mechanization of oil palm frond cutter. The focus is on using a different type of cutting tool, instead of using a sickle. A rotary cutting tool is introduced in this project. The most suitable cutting tool is the large straight router bit; because, the ability of this cutting tool is better when compared to other tested cutting tools bit. Moreover, the cutting angle during cutting of OPF are studied and the result shows that a 30-degree angle is the most suitable as the cutting speed is much faster compared to others. Furthermore, this project’s prototype will be used with a robotic system in future development. The housing of cutter prototype is working properly during the experiment. Besides that, this prototype is powered by an electrical source compared to previous technology, using a small engine as power source.
